LP2985IM5X-2.0 Equivalent & Substitute Parts

Part Overview

The LP2985IM5X-2.0 is a linear voltage regulator IC from Texas Instruments, delivering positive fixed 2V output at 150mA in SOT-23-5 surface mount packaging. This device is classified as obsolete, making equivalent and substitute parts necessary for ongoing design support and procurement continuity. The regulator integrates over-current, over-temperature, and short-circuit protection with an enable control feature, operating across -40°C to 125°C.

Substitute Part Grouping Explanation

Substitution for the LP2985IM5X-2.0 is determined by strict alignment of electrical and mechanical parameters. The critical substitution criteria are:

Electrical Parameters (Must Match):

  • Output voltage: 2V fixed
  • Output current capability: 150mA minimum
  • Input voltage range: 16V maximum or higher
  • Voltage dropout: 0.58V @ 150mA or lower
  • Operating temperature range: -40°C to 125°C
  • Protection features: Over-current, over-temperature, short-circuit
  • Control features: Enable function

Mechanical Parameters (Must Match):

  • Package type: SOT-23-5 or TSOT-23-5
  • Mounting type: Surface mount

Substitute parts are grouped into two categories:

Direct Equivalents (Parametric Match): LP2985IM5-2.0/NOPB, LP2985AIM5-2.0/NOPB, LP2985AIM5X-2.0/NOPB, and LP2985IM5X-2.0/NOPB meet all electrical and mechanical specifications identically. These differ only in product status and packaging format (tape & reel, cut tape, or bulk).

Functional Equivalents (Reduced Output Current): LT1761ES5-2#TRMPBF, LT1761ES5-2#TRPBF, and LT1761IS5-2#TRPBF from Analog Devices provide 2V fixed output with 100mA current capability. These are suitable where the application requires less than 100mA. They offer superior voltage dropout (0.45V @ 100mA) and higher input voltage tolerance (20V maximum).

Alternative with Reduced Input Voltage Range: MIC5247-2.0YM5-TR from Microchip Technology delivers 150mA at 2V output with exceptional voltage dropout (0.15V @ 150mA). However, its maximum input voltage is limited to 6V, restricting use to applications with lower input voltage sources.

Engineering Selection Recommendations

For Direct Replacement (Identical Specifications): Select LP2985IM5-2.0/NOPB (Active status, tape & reel packaging) as the primary choice for new designs and production continuity. This part maintains all electrical and mechanical specifications of the obsolete LP2985IM5X-2.0 while offering active product status and established supply availability.

For Reduced Current Applications (≤100mA): The LT1761 series (LT1761ES5-2#TRMPBF, LT1761ES5-2#TRPBF, LT1761IS5-2#TRPBF) from Analog Devices provides superior performance characteristics with lower voltage dropout (0.45V vs. 0.58V) and higher input voltage tolerance (20V vs. 16V). These are suitable for applications where output current does not exceed 100mA. All three variants are in active production status with ROHS3 compliance.

For Low Input Voltage Applications (≤6V): MIC5247-2.0YM5-TR offers exceptional voltage dropout performance (0.15V @ 150mA) and maintains 150mA output current capability. This part is restricted to input voltage sources not exceeding 6V. Select this only when input voltage range limitation aligns with application requirements and superior dropout performance is critical.

Compliance Considerations: All recommended substitutes carry ROHS3 compliance and REACH unaffected status. The original LP2985IM5X-2.0 is RoHS non-compliant; migration to compliant alternatives is recommended for new designs and long-term supply security.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can LP2985IM5-2.0/NOPB directly replace LP2985IM5X-2.0 in existing designs?

A: Yes. Both parts share identical electrical specifications (2V output, 150mA current, 0.58V dropout @ 150mA, 16V input maximum) and mechanical packaging (SOT-23-5). The difference is product status (active vs. obsolete) and packaging format. No circuit modifications are required.

Q: What is the difference between LP2985IM5X-2.0/NOPB and LP2985IM5-2.0/NOPB?

A: Both are from National Semiconductor and Texas Instruments respectively, with identical electrical parameters. The primary difference is packaging format: LP2985IM5X-2.0/NOPB is supplied in bulk, while LP2985IM5-2.0/NOPB is supplied in tape & reel format. Select based on procurement and assembly requirements.

Q: Why would I choose LT1761 over LP2985 if the current is lower?

A: LT1761 variants are suitable when application current requirements do not exceed 100mA. They offer advantages including lower voltage dropout (0.45V vs. 0.58V), higher input voltage tolerance (20V vs. 16V), and active production status. These characteristics reduce power dissipation and provide greater design margin in high-input-voltage applications.

Q: Is MIC5247-2.0YM5-TR a suitable replacement for 150mA applications?

A: MIC5247-2.0YM5-TR maintains 150mA output current and offers superior voltage dropout (0.15V @ 150mA). However, its maximum input voltage is limited to 6V. Use this part only in applications where input voltage does not exceed 6V. If your application requires higher input voltage (up to 16V), select LP2985IM5-2.0/NOPB instead.

Q: Are all substitute parts available in SOT-23-5 packaging?

A: LP2985 variants are supplied in SOT-23-5 (SC-74A, SOT-753). LT1761 variants use TSOT-23-5 (SOT-23-5 Thin), which is mechanically and electrically compatible with standard SOT-23-5 footprints. MIC5247-2.0YM5-TR is supplied in SOT-23-5. All are surface mount compatible with standard SOT-23-5 PCB layouts.

Q: What is the difference between LT1761ES5-2#TRMPBF and LT1761ES5-2#TRPBF?

A: Both parts are electrically identical with 100mA output, 2V fixed output, and 0.45V dropout @ 100mA. The difference is in tape packaging material specification (TRMPBF vs. TRPBF). Select based on your assembly process requirements; both are functionally equivalent for circuit design purposes.

Q: Are all substitute parts RoHS compliant?

A: Yes. LP2985IM5-2.0/NOPB, LP2985AIM5-2.0/NOPB, LP2985AIM5X-2.0/NOPB, all LT1761 variants, and MIC5247-2.0YM5-TR carry ROHS3 compliance. The original LP2985IM5X-2.0 is RoHS non-compliant. Migration to compliant alternatives is recommended for regulatory alignment.
